I am a semi retired veterinarian and a new member. I have always been interested in Parkers and owned a Parker Reproduction in 28ga several years ago (no longer have it). But today I purchased my first Vintage Parker. A 16ga on an O frame. SWEET. I would like to know more about it. The serial # is 153768 Has a large V on the frame and above it is an oblong circle with what looks like a VM. I con't find much info for a V grade. I saw info on VH but not on a V by itself I tried to joint on the PGCA online tonight but couldn't get the payment system to come up so I am sending in a paper application that I downloaded. a V is a VH - the H just means hammerless - some grades began in the hammer gun days, so the H is used to differencate the two
